Ensuring the safety and durability of hydraulic steel dams is crucial for both water management and environmental protection. As these structures play a critical role in water treatment processes, industry experts emphasize various strategies that hydraulic steel dam suppliers can adopt.

According to Dr. Emily Carter, a materials engineer with over 20 years in the industry, “The choice of materials is paramount. Suppliers should prioritize high-grade steel that can withstand corrosive elements common in water environments.” She stresses the importance of using corrosion-resistant coatings to extend the life of the dam.
James Thornton, a senior engineer specializing in hydraulic structures, notes the significance of rigorous quality assurance protocols. “Regular inspections and testing both during and after the construction phase can mitigate risks. Hydraulic steel dam suppliers must adopt stringent quality control measures,” he explains.
Laura Chen, an expert in structural engineering, argues that innovative design can significantly enhance safety. “Utilizing advanced design software allows for better stress analysis and simulation under various conditions,” she states. This foresight can help suppliers create designs that are not only durable but also capable of adapting to extreme environmental changes.

Mark Robinson, a project manager with years of experience in water treatment facilities, suggests implementing thorough maintenance programs. “Hydraulic steel dam suppliers should propose maintenance schedules to their clients as part of the service. This prevents minor issues from escalating into major failures,” he advises, emphasizing the importance of proactive care in prolonging a dam’s lifespan.
Training personnel involved in the construction and maintenance of hydraulic steel dams is another critical factor. Sally Answorth, an industry consultant, highlights the need for ongoing education. “Workers must be familiar with the latest best practices and safety standards. Proper training ensures the integrity of the dam and the safety of the community it serves,” she concludes.
Another aspect that cannot be overlooked is community engagement. Expert researcher Dr. Michael Lee states, “Hydraulic steel dam suppliers should keep open lines of communication with local communities. Feedback from those directly affected can lead to improvements in safety measures and operational practices.” This collaborative approach not only builds trust but also enhances the overall effectiveness of water management systems.
In conclusion, to ensure safety and durability, hydraulic steel dam suppliers must focus on material quality, rigorous inspection protocols, innovative designs, maintenance programs, personnel training, and community engagement. By integrating these strategies, suppliers can significantly enhance the performance and reliability of hydraulic steel dams, thereby contributing to better water treatment practices and sustainable management of resources.
